    When your HVAC system starts making strange noises, it’s often trying to tell you something. Here’s a breakdown of common sounds and their meanings:

    1. Banging Noises

    Banging sounds can indicate loose or broken parts within your furnace or air conditioning unit. This could involve:

    • Loose panels
    • Broken motor mounts
    • Issues with ductwork

    2. Hissing Sounds

    Hissing noises may suggest that your refrigerant lines are leaking or that there’s air escaping from your ducts. This could lead to inefficient cooling and higher energy costs.

    3. Whistling Noises

    Whistling typically results from airflow issues, possibly caused by:

    • Dirty air filters
    • Obstructions in ductwork

    4. Clicking Sounds

    A clicking noise can occur due to electrical issues in your thermostat or faulty relays within the furnace or AC unit.

    5. Squealing or Screeching

    Such sounds often point to problems with fan belts or bearings that require immediate attention—ignoring them might lead to more severe damage.

    6. Gurgling Noises

    Gurgling sounds may indicate a blocked drain line or low refrigerant levels in your AC unit.

    Table: Common Noises & Their Meanings

    | Noise Type | Possible Cause | Recommended Action | |-------------------|-------------------------------------|-------------------------------------| | Banging | Loose parts | Schedule inspection | | Hissing | Refrigerant leak | Call emergency repair | | Whistling | Airflow obstruction | Check/filter change | | Clicking | Electrical issues | Inspect thermostat | | Squealing | Worn belts/bearings | Immediate repair | | Gurgling | Blocked drain line | Clean drain lines |
